Alsace-Lorraine was taken over by Germany from France in the Franco-Prussian war in 1871. Belgium was invaded by Germany during world War 1. At the End of the World War 1, The Treaty of Versailles was formed to declare the defeat of Germany in World War 1.

As per the Treaty, Germany returned the Alsace –Lorraine Territory back to France and they had to surrender small amount of German Territory to Belgium after the World War 1. Thus they lost control of both the states and many territories.
